Transaction a0fa024121be4cec590a5680781483608916f705461a1d659c10d3c49631fb38
1 Input
2 Outputs
- a0fa024121be4cec590a5680781483608916f705461a1d659c10d3c49631fb38:0
- a0fa024121be4cec590a5680781483608916f705461a1d659c10d3c49631fb38:1
value 20100509
address 1EgjkwpM5crgxKR4JtZA25bTACh9XzXCMg
value 16331806
address 1Q2D2UCvjubCQN5UQnGA6G6Te8p6qLvmRf